раздел /boot - восстановить burg (grub) [РЕШЕНО]

Изображение пользователя tigris.

случайно (почти) затер раздел /boot, сейчас стоит бург, вот вывод:

tigris@tigris-D440:~$ sudo update-burg
Generating burg.cfg ...
Found linux image: /boot/vmlinuz-2.6.35-28-generic
Found initrd image: /boot/initrd.img-2.6.35-28-generic
Found Windows 7 (loader) on /dev/sda1
Found Kubuntu 10.10 (10.10) on /dev/sda6
done

вот как мне теперь kubuntu загрузить? в меню бурга этой строки нет (((

0
vetal.44 - 21 Март, 2011 - 21:51
Изображение пользователя vetal.44.

Попробуй sudo apt-get install grub-pc --reinstall
sudo update-grub2
Ну или то же самое, только с burg.

0
tigris - 21 Март, 2011 - 22:35
Изображение пользователя tigris.

неа... собственно забыл сказать, что изначально стояло win7+kubuntu, потом начал ставить ubuntu, затер /boot, соответственно ничего кроме убунты не появилось, установил бург, он увидел и убунту и винду и кубунту, но в меню выбора появились только убунту и винда, хочу вернуть кубунту.

0
tigris - 21 Март, 2011 - 23:16
Изображение пользователя tigris.

никто не знает? ((( неужели переставлять кубунту? я же все затру, у меня там все так классно настроено было
(((

0
vetal.44 - 21 Март, 2011 - 23:25
Изображение пользователя vetal.44.

Ну так оставьте /home. И все настройки сохранятся. Не понимаю зачем Вы ставили Ubuntu. Если из-за Gnome, можно было установить пакет ubuntu-desktop и все.

0
tigris - 21 Март, 2011 - 23:39
Изображение пользователя tigris.

убунту ставил для экспериментов, не хотелось все делать на основной системе.

0
vetal.44 - 21 Март, 2011 - 23:23
Изображение пользователя vetal.44.

Примерно понял. В /boot кроме Grub также лежит ядро. Тогда сделайте так:
sudo chroot /каталог_с_корнем_Kubuntu
dpkg-query -l linux-image-* |grep ^ii |grep -v e-g
В ответ получите список установленных ядер и названий пакетов. Название пакета, с которым пришло ядро, выглядит как-то так: linux-image-2.6.35-28-generic
apt-get install linux-image-2.6.35-28-generic --reinstall
exit
sudo update-grub2
Правда если Вы в /boot установили Ubuntu, к Kubuntu его уже не подключайте.
Хотя по моему проще установить на Ubuntu пакет kubuntu-desktop, а Kubuntu форматнуть. Смотрите сами.
Ps Если chroot вернет ошибку, значит Вы не правильно указали каталог.

0
DarkneSS - 22 Март, 2011 - 00:01
Изображение пользователя DarkneSS.

Если бунты одной версии, то можно продублировать в конфиге груба нужную строку, но поменять раздел, с котрого грузиться. Если разных, то можно скачать нужные дебы, положить в бут те файлы ядра кубунту, которых не хватает и создать строчку в грубе руками.

+1
tigris - 22 Март, 2011 - 00:30
Изображение пользователя tigris.

в общем сделал так, под chroot'ом сделал как написал vetal.44 (отдельное спасибо), затем установил груб, вышел назад в убунту и прописал строку меню как советовал даркнесс (тоже большое спасибо), после загрузки кубунты подправил ручками fstab, т.к. он ссылался на /boot, теперь все три системы грузятся нормально. спасибо всем!!!

Отправить комментарий

CAPTCHA на основе изображений
Введите цифры